style: unify identifier naming per updated conventions

Automated with clang-tidy readability-identifier-naming (config added to
.clang-tidy) plus scripted passes, per the updated rules now documented
in CONTRIBUTING.md:

- types (class/struct/enum/alias/template params): PascalCase
- functions, variables, members: snake_case (incl. rational -> Rational)
- private/protected members: trailing underscore; static member
  variables likewise (instance_, available_themes_)
- constants and enum values: snake_case (kLinear -> k_linear,
  F32P -> f32p); ALL_CAPS reserved for macros
- macros: OAK_ prefix (OLIVE_ADD_TEST/OLIVE_ASSERT/OLIVE_CONFIG ->
  OAK_ADD_TEST/OAK_ASSERT/OAK_CONFIG, GL_PREAMBLE -> OAK_GL_PREAMBLE,
  include guards -> OAK_*)
- file names: all lowercase (Current/Plugin/OliveHost/OliveClip/
  OlivePluginInstance -> current/plugin/olivehost/oliveclip/
  oliveplugininstance)
- getters share the member name sans underscore, setters set_foo()
- Qt and third-party (OpenFX) virtual overrides and framework callbacks
  keep their original names (exempt in .clang-tidy)

Manual follow-ups required where automation could not reach:
- string-based QMetaObject/SIGNAL/SLOT references updated to renamed
  methods (AddTask, CreatedFile, DeleteSpecificFile, moveSelectionUp, ...)
- macro bodies referencing renamed methods (OLIVE_CONFIG,
  NODE_DEFAULT_DESTRUCTOR, MANAGEDDISPLAYWIDGET_*)
- self-shadowing locals renamed where signals/methods became same-named
  (size_changed, worker_count, selected_items, import param, filters)
- third_party OFX member/namespace usages restored (OFX::Host::*,
  _created, _clipPrefsDirty, createInstance, clearPersistentMessage)
- STL protocol aliases restored (const_iterator) with .clang-tidy
  ignore rules; qHash overloads restored

Full build and test suite pass: ctest 4/4, ~1960 gtest cases green.
